Product Overview

Remote.com
Remote.com

Description: Remote.com is a service that helps companies hire remote workers around the world. It handles payroll, benefits, compliance, and more to simplify remote hiring. Remote.com screens candidates and matches companies with vetted remote talent.

Type: software

WebEmployed
WebEmployed

Description: WebEmployed is a cloud-based applicant tracking and recruiting software designed for small to midsize businesses. It allows companies to post jobs, screen resumes, track applicants, conduct interviews, and make hiring decisions all in one easy-to-use platform.

Type: software
